Another long and hot day. Mowed the rest of the hay and tedded almost all of it, finishing at 10 pm. Not quite as hot as a couple of days ago, but still +27°C and the hay is drying well. Just need to keep in mind not to dry myself!

The last fields have a lot of clover and also some alfalfa and they were a pain to rake. The long and thick stems can wind around the rotors of the rake and you have be quick to react when that starts happening. They are also slow to dry, so I think they won't dry quickly enough to be baled without wrapping.
